Have you ever considered how information travels, invisible, through the air? Right here stands Su00f8sterhu00f8jsenderen, a silent sentinel of the airwaves. Since its inauguration in May 1956, this unassuming tower has played a crucial role in broadcasting. The Su00f8sterhu00f8jsenderen doesn’t just transmit radio waves, it broadcasts history. The tower witnessed a tragic event in 1975. A small plane, shrouded in fog, misjudged its course and collided with one of the tower’s guy-wires. This accident sadly claimed the lives of the pilot and his son. Today, the Su00f8sterhu00f8jsenderen stands as a reminder of the delicate balance between progress and risk, of the unseen forces that shape our world.
